Get the official AQA GCSE Physics Paper 1 Higher Tier question paper from the May 2025 exam series (8463/1H). This examiner-authentic PDF contains the complete Higher Tier Physics Paper 1 in its original AQA exam layout, including tidal-turbine calculations, specific heat capacity investigations, LED current–potential difference analysis, carbon-emission graphs, nuclear-fusion questions, radioactive decay calculations, latent-heat calculations, gravitational potential energy equations, spring-energy calculations, and extended-response physics questions exactly as candidates received them in the live examination.

This 2025 Physics 1H paper assesses renewable and non-renewable energy resources, tidal and wind turbines, density and flow-rate calculations, specific heat capacity practicals, energy transfer and insulation, LED resistance calculations, carbon dioxide emissions from electric and petrol cars, nuclear fusion and isotopes, radioactive contamination and irradiation, half-life calculations, latent heat of vaporisation, gas pressure and particle motion, electric motors and efficiency, gravitational potential energy, spring constants, kinetic energy, loop-the-loop energy transfers, and light-gate speed measurements across the AQA GCSE Physics specification. It includes graph interpretation, six-mark required-practical methods, equation-sheet application, multi-step calculations, data analysis, and extended-response physics tasks exactly as tested in the live Higher Tier examination.
